Efficiency is a measure of how well the system performs its intended task, taking into account its input and output, and can be measured using time, energy, materials, or cost. This means that the larger the output relative to the input, the greater the efficiency of the system.

So, how can you ensure that your system is as efficient as possible? The key lies in its design, the quality of its components, and the environment in which it operates. Poor design, inferior components, and an unsuitable environment can all adversely affect the efficiency of a system. Similarly, user mistakes or inexperience can also lead to a decrease in efficiency.

Real-World Examples of Efficiency of the System

In today’s competitive environment, it is more important than ever to ensure that your business is as efficient as possible. By taking advantage of automated systems, you can save time, money, and energy. Here are just a few examples of how automated systems can help you achieve greater efficiency in the real world:

  1. Automated customer service systems are great for quickly and easily checking on the status of orders. They provide customers with real-time updates, eliminating the need for manual customer service inquiries.
  2. Automated scheduling systems can optimize resource utilization and minimize wasted time. By streamlining the scheduling process, businesses can save money and increase productivity.
  3. Automated production systems can minimize material waste and maximize output. By using predictive analytics, potential problems can be identified before they occur, preventing costly downtime and repair expenses.
  4. Automated systems can also help optimize energy consumption and reduce costs. By analyzing energy usage patterns, businesses can identify areas where energy can be conserved, leading to lower energy bills.

Benefits and Drawbacks of Efficiency of the System

Achieving efficiency in business operations is a goal for many businesses. There are many benefits of having an efficient system in place, including improved customer satisfaction, streamlined processes, increased accuracy, and reduced waste and errors.

However, there are also drawbacks to having an efficient system in place. These include a high initial investment, a complex implementation process, difficulty in making changes to the system, potential security risks, and potential for misuse of the system.
